Minister of Foreign Affairs and International Cooperation,\u00a0Sheikh Abdullah bin Zayed\u00a0condemned Tuesday\u2019s terror attacks in Istanbul\u00a0and expressed his condolences, while stating that UAE supported Turkey in its fight against terrorism.<\/p>\n
The tragic incident (triple suicide bombing and a gun attack)\u00a0which took place in\u00a0Istanbul\u2019s Ataturk Airport\u00a0yesterday killed at least 41 people.\u00a0Attackers began spraying bullets at the international terminal entrance before blowing themselves up at about 10pm Istanbul time (that’s 11pm UAE time).<\/p>\n
Prime minister Binali Yildirim said the ‘evidence points to Daesh’.<\/p>\n<\/p>\n
